Nkosinomusa Moyo CA(SA) currently serves as Financial Manager at Unitrans Africa since November 2021, previously holding the position of Financial Accountant. From April 2018 to October 2021, Nkosinomusa was Group Accountant: Management Information at SAFE - South African Fruit Exporters, where responsibilities included preparing month-end financial reports, managing audit processes, and communicating with stakeholders. Prior experience includes an Accounting Trainee role at Moore Stephens South Africa from February 2015 to March 2018, focusing on audit and accounting services across various sectors. Nkosinomusa's educational background includes a Postgraduate Diploma in Applied Accounting Sciences from the University of South Africa, a Bachelor of Commerce (Honours) in Management Accounting, and a Bachelor of Commerce in Accounting, both from Rhodes University.

Unitrans is a diversified contractual logistics company serving the needs of selected sub-Saharan African markets. Our company’s successful business model incorporates the design, implementation and ongoing provision of supply chain solutions for its customers. Africa presents great commercial opportunities for those with a bold vision and persistent drive to find the right way. Unitrans Africa has demonstrated this ability and ongoing desire to leave a positive mark on the economic development of Sub-Sahara Africa serving more than 650 million people. Unitrans serves several leading global companies with its service offerings whilst building and developing mutually beneficial and trusted commercial partnerships. Decades of fostering deep relationships have laid the foundations for a growing logistic network spanning 9 countries. Unitrans Africa moves millions of tons of goods and operates on 9 of the biggest African agriculture estates covering more than 100,000 hectares in total.
